Nia Jetter is a seasoned expert in intelligent optimization, artificial intelligence, and control systems, with over two decades of experience advancing critical technologies in the aerospace and robotics industries. She is passionate about using innovation and strategic technology planning to solve complex problems in autonomy and AI across diverse applications. As both an engineer and advocate for equitable access to technology, Nia is committed to creating solutions that are impactful and inclusive.

She spent 20 years as an Aerospace Engineer, making significant contributions to major initiatives—including algorithm development and mission-critical work on the ~$1B GPS IIF satellite program. In January 2021, she transitioned from her role as a Technical Fellow to join Amazon as a Senior Principal Technologist in Robotics AI. This executive-level role represents a top-tier individual contributor track, reserved for highly accomplished practicing engineers who provide technical leadership, shape innovation strategies, and deliver impactful engineering solutions at scale. Nia leads the development of safety-critical autonomous systems with a continued focus on hands-on impact and engineering excellence.

A champion for accessible STEM education, Nia is the founder of the Distinguished Minds Institute, operating as thinqueBytes®, a nonprofit focused on demystifying complex technologies through creative, inclusive learning—such as her Rockets and Robotics program.  In 2023, she spent a few weeks in Ghana teaching her Rockets and Robotics curriculum—an experience that reaffirmed her commitment to expanding access to STEM globally.

Nia holds a B.S. in Mathematics with Computer Science from MIT (with a minor in Earth, Atmospheric, and Planetary Sciences) and an M.S. in Aeronautical and Astronautical Engineering from Stanford. Nia enjoys science fiction, astronomy, dancing, baking, traveling, and designing engaging learning experiences that make advanced topics approachable and inspiring.
